Visualizing impacts of an optimization pass helps to reason about, and to gain insight into, the inner workings of the optimization pass. In this paper, we visualize the impacts of two procedural abstraction passes. For this, we modified two procedural abstraction post pass optimizers to visualize for each the difference in machine code before and after optimization by drawing abstracted fragments in the original program. We then explain how the generated visualizations aid in better understanding the optimization passes
